public class SimpleParameterValidator
extends java.lang.Object
Constructor and Description |
---|
SimpleParameterValidator() |
Modifier and Type | Method and Description |
---|---|
protected PrimitiveValidator<?> |
getValidator(java.lang.Class<?> keyClass,
io.swagger.models.parameters.SerializableParameter param) |
protected java.lang.String |
invalidTypeMessage(io.swagger.models.parameters.SerializableParameter param,
java.lang.String value,
int index) |
protected java.lang.Object |
parse(java.lang.Class<?> keyClass,
io.swagger.models.parameters.SerializableParameter param,
java.lang.String value,
int index,
Result result) |
protected Result |
validate(SwaggerRequest request,
io.swagger.models.parameters.Parameter param,
java.lang.String value,
boolean strict) |
protected Result validate(SwaggerRequest request, io.swagger.models.parameters.Parameter param, java.lang.String value, boolean strict) throws ValidationException
ValidationException
protected java.lang.Object parse(java.lang.Class<?> keyClass, io.swagger.models.parameters.SerializableParameter param, java.lang.String value, int index, Result result) throws ValidationException
ValidationException
protected java.lang.String invalidTypeMessage(io.swagger.models.parameters.SerializableParameter param, java.lang.String value, int index)
protected PrimitiveValidator<?> getValidator(java.lang.Class<?> keyClass, io.swagger.models.parameters.SerializableParameter param)
Copyright © 2018